Understanding Okra

Before we dive into the specifics of how many okra are in a 5-gallon bucket, it’s essential to understand a bit about okra itself. Okra, also known as lady’s fingers, is a flowering plant that belongs to the mallow family. It’s a popular vegetable in many parts of the world, particularly in Africa, Asia, and the Southern United States. Okra is known for its green, pod-like structure, which is typically harvested when it’s young and tender. The size and shape of okra pods can vary significantly, depending on the variety, growing conditions, and stage of maturity.

Factors Affecting Okra Size and Quantity

Several factors can influence the size and quantity of okra in a 5-gallon bucket. These include:

The variety of okra: Different okra varieties can produce pods of varying sizes. Some popular varieties, such as ‘Clemson Spineless’ and ‘Red Burgundy’, tend to produce larger pods, while others, like ‘Lady Finger’ and ‘Dwarf Green’, produce smaller ones.
The growing conditions: Weather, soil quality, and watering practices can all impact the size and quantity of okra pods. For example, okra plants that receive adequate moisture and nutrients tend to produce more and larger pods.
The stage of maturity: Okra pods that are harvested at an immature stage will be smaller than those that are allowed to mature fully.
The packing method: How the okra is packed into the bucket can also affect the quantity. If the okra is packed loosely, with ample space between each pod, the total number will be lower than if the okra is packed tightly, with minimal gaps.

Estimating Okra Quantity

To estimate the number of okra in a 5-gallon bucket, we need to consider the average size of the okra pods and the packing method. A 5-gallon bucket has a volume of approximately 18.9 liters. The size of okra pods can vary from about 2 to 10 inches (5 to 25 cm) in length and from 1 to 2 inches (2.5 to 5 cm) in width. Assuming an average pod size of about 4-6 inches (10-15 cm) in length and 1.5 inches (3.8 cm) in width, we can estimate the volume of a single okra pod to be around 0.05-0.1 liters.

Using this estimate, we can calculate the maximum number of okra pods that can fit in a 5-gallon bucket, assuming they are packed tightly without any gaps. However, in reality, it’s unlikely that the okra will be packed without any spaces, so we need to account for the packing efficiency.

A common rule of thumb for estimating the packing efficiency of irregularly shaped objects, like okra pods, is to assume a packing efficiency of around 50-60%. This means that about 50-60% of the volume of the bucket will be occupied by the okra, while the remaining 40-50% will be empty space.

Calculating the Number of Okra

Based on these estimates, let’s calculate the number of okra that can fit in a 5-gallon bucket.

The volume of the bucket is approximately 18.9 liters. Assuming a packing efficiency of 55%, the effective volume occupied by the okra will be around 10.4 liters (18.9 x 0.55).

The volume of a single okra pod is approximately 0.075 liters (midpoint of the estimated range of 0.05-0.1 liters).

Now, we can calculate the number of okra that can fit in the bucket:

Number of okra = Effective volume occupied by okra / Volume of a single okra pod
= 10.4 liters / 0.075 liters
= approximately 139 okra pods

However, this calculation assumes that the okra is packed very tightly, with minimal gaps. In practice, the actual number of okra in a 5-gallon bucket may be lower due to the packing method and the size variation of the okra pods.

Can you estimate the number of okra in a 5-gallon bucket based on weight?

Estimating the number of okra in a 5-gallon bucket based on weight can be a bit tricky, as the weight of a single okra pod can vary greatly depending on its size and moisture content. However, if you know the average weight of a single okra pod, you can estimate the total number of pods in the bucket based on its overall weight. For example, if the average okra pod weighs around 0.25 pounds, and the bucket weighs 20 pounds when full, you can estimate that there are around 80 okra pods in the bucket (20 pounds / 0.25 pounds per pod).

To get a more accurate estimate, you would need to know the weight of the empty bucket and the weight of the okra itself. You can then subtract the weight of the bucket from the total weight to get the weight of the okra, and divide this by the weight of a single pod to get the total number of pods. Keep in mind that this method is not foolproof, as the weight of the okra can vary depending on its moisture content and other factors. However, it can provide a rough estimate of the number of okra in a 5-gallon bucket.
